TM 320 Screw connections testing

The main element of the unit is a slotted, elastically deformable steel block. By tightening the bolt joint, the slotted area is deformed, thereby generating an axial tension force in the bolt. The resulting deformation is recorded by a mechanical dial gauge, and is directly related to the bolt tension force generated.
The bolt joint is tightened and slackened using a special torque wrench, which can be set sensitively with the aid of a threaded spindle. By using an axial bearing, the head friction of the bolt can be largely excluded, so that only the friction of the threaded joint is measured.

  • correlation between tightening torque and tension force on standardised bolts
  • breakaway torque of a bolt joint

Tension force

  • max. 40kN

Force/travel constant

  • 20kN/mm (on slotted block)

Max. tightening torque

  • 40Nm

Torque/travel constant

  • 10Nm/mm (on torque measuring device)

Dial gauge

  • 0…10mm
  • graduation: 0,01mm
  1. experiment on the correlation between the tension force and tightening torque of bolts
  2. bolt size M8x100, wrench jaw size 13mm
  3. elastic deformation of a slotted block by the bolt
  4. determining the tightening and breakaway torque with a mechanical torque measuring device
  5. 2 dial gauges
  6. sensitive torque setting by hand wheel
  • axial tension force in a bolt joint dependent on the tightening torque or the elastic deformation of a slotted block
  • measurement of the breakaway torque, including for different fitting situations of the bolt joint
  • measurement of thread friction and overall friction
